I am interested in obtaining information on any cell/molecular biology
software
that might be appropriate for the high school level.  (I am the director of a
summer institute for high school science teachers.)  I would appreciate any
information that would supplement both lecture and lab.  Specific topics I am
interested in include:

1.  Bacterial growth
2.  Chromosome structure and cell division
3.  Biomolecules
4.  Protein structure and function
5.  DNA structure and function

Inexpensive biological software for the Mac
is available from Intellimation Library for the 
Macintosh, Dept YAH, POB 1922, Santa Barbara, CA
93116-1922.  Phone 1-800-346-8355.  Most programs
are less than $50 and lab pack prices are
available.  60 day trial, etc, etc....
